|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Inverter does not power on | Power supply issue | Check input power and connections. |
| Error code displayed | Fault condition | Refer to the user manual for error code meanings. |
| Low output power | Overload condition | Reduce load and reset the inverter. |
| Inverter shuts down | Overtemperature | Ensure proper ventilation and cooling. |
